Smoked Salmon and Prawn Cocktail Starter

(Serves 4)
 
4 Handfuls of washed cosmopolitan salad
120 Grams Smoked Salmon cut into small pieces
250 Grams Cooked peeled Prawns
6 Heaped tablespoons Mayonnaise
1 1/2 Heaped tablespoon Tomato Ketchup
1 Tablespoon Lemon Juice
Black Pepper to taste
Worcester Sauce.
 
Method
 
1. Chop the salad a little to make it more manageable, then divide into 4 large wine glasses or similar.
2. Mix Mayonnaise, Lemon Juice and Tomato Ketchup together in a bowl
3. Add the prawns and smoked Salmon
4. Divide evenly between glasses
5. If liked drizzle over a little worcester sauce for an extra kick.
 
Top tip: Buy Smoked Salmon pieces if available much more economical.

We recommend a crisp Sauvgnon Blanc to serve with this delicious starter.
